Output 508e5c7d98c724d1c31f972db551a3b91bcbbdf0b26202ec333b0522b4951c25:3

value
40669600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c564779742e302bc2557870bf71a25fd1955de OP_EQUAL
address
3LuUHtvPFtki65xtGqU2QJ2HVAr3paioxh
transaction
508e5c7d98c724d1c31f972db551a3b91bcbbdf0b26202ec333b0522b4951c25
confirmations
188776
spent
true